Welcome to Kade's Casita where we invite you and your family to come visit this unique 100 year old home in the heart of Kingfisher. You are greeted by a spacious living room that opens to the formal dining room followed by the kitchen. You will stay in one of three bedrooms outfitted with queen and twin beds. Feel free to take advantage of the washer and dryer as well as enjoy your morning coffee in the sun room. Spacious 2 car attached garage is available with every stay! Come enjoy your stay!

Our third stay at this property. Very clean and nice for a home of this age. The upstairs stays warm with the air conditioner ON. This is typical of duct systems designed for heating with most of the air going downstairs. The kitchen is not well stocked with coffee cups, glasses and dishes and we brought our own.
